SQL or Structured Query Language is a critical tool for data professionals. It is undoubtedly the most important language for getting a job in the field of data analysis or data sciences.
Millions of data points are being generated every minute and raw data does not have any story to tell. After all this data gets stored in databases and professionals use SQL to extract this data for further analysis.
SQL is the most common language for extracting and organising data that is stored in a relational database.
A database is a table that consists of rows and columns. SQL is the language of databases.
It facilitates retrieving specific information from databases that are further used for analysis.
SQL can be used to:
Execute queries against a database
Retrieve data from a database
Insert records into a database
Update records in a database
Delete records from a database
Create new databases, or new tables in a database
Create stored procedures & views in a database
Set permissions on tables, procedures, and views
Backup and restore data
Join data from multiple tables
Microsoft SQL Server is a relational database management system developed by Microsoft. As a database server, it is a software product with the primary function of storing and retrieving data as requested by other
software applications-which may run either on the same computer or on another computer across a network.
PostgreSQL, also known as Postgres, is a free and open-source relational database management system emphasizing extensibility and SQL compliance.
